Metal Roof Pergola

Metal pergola roofs are renowned for their exceptional durability and weather resistance, making them ideal for regions with extreme climatic conditions such as the Middle East or parts of South America. They are often fabricated from aluminum or steel, offering a wide range of colors and styles, allowing customization to match architectural aesthetics. For B2B buyers, sourcing high-quality metal panels with appropriate coatings (e.g., powder coating) ensures longevity and reduces maintenance costs. Considerations include weight, which may necessitate reinforced structures, and potential noise during rain, which can be mitigated with insulation or soundproofing.

Polycarbonate Roof

Polycarbonate is a versatile roofing material favored in commercial and hospitality projects across Europe and Africa due to its impact resistance and UV protection. Its translucency allows natural light to permeate while blocking harmful UV rays, creating comfortable outdoor environments. B2B buyers should evaluate the thickness and coating options to balance transparency with durability. Ease of installation and minimal maintenance make it attractive for large-scale projects. However, polycarbonate can scratch easily and may yellow over time, impacting aesthetics, which warrants selecting high-quality, UV-stabilized variants.

Fabric Pergola Roof

Fabric pergola roofs offer a flexible and cost-effective solution, particularly suitable for temporary or semi-permanent outdoor structures in South America and the Middle East. Made from high-performance textiles, these roofs are designed to withstand UV exposure and light rain. They are easy to install and replace, making them appealing for event venues or seasonal installations. For B2B buyers, attention should be paid to fabric durability, seam quality, and the fabric’s resistance to mold and UV degradation. While economical, fabric roofs are less suitable for harsh weather conditions and may require frequent replacement in extreme climates.

Wooden Pergola Roof

Wooden pergola roofs provide a natural, aesthetic appeal that complements traditional and high-end residential projects in Europe and Africa. They can be customized with various finishes, stains, or paints to match architectural styles. From a procurement perspective, B2B buyers should consider the type of wood (e.g., cedar, redwood, or treated pine) for durability and resistance to pests and rot. The longer lead times and higher maintenance requirements are factors to account for in project planning. Proper treatment and sealing extend lifespan, but ongoing maintenance is essential to preserve appearance and structural integrity.

Aluminum Pergola Roof

Aluminum roofs are gaining popularity in urban and contemporary settings across Europe and the Middle East due to their sleek appearance and corrosion resistance. They are lightweight, facilitating easier installation and reducing structural load requirements. Aluminum’s reflective properties help keep outdoor spaces cooler, advantageous in hot climates. For B2B buyers, sourcing high-grade aluminum with durable powder coatings ensures longevity and aesthetic consistency. While the initial cost is higher than some alternatives, the low maintenance and long lifespan offer significant lifecycle cost advantages, making them a strategic choice for commercial developments and upscale residential projects.

Metal (Aluminum and Steel)

Metal remains a popular choice for pergola roofing due to its high durability and strength. Aluminum, in particular, is lightweight, corrosion-resistant, and requires minimal maintenance, making it suitable for diverse climates, including humid coastal areas in South America or the Middle East. Steel, especially galvanized or powder-coated variants, offers superior strength and impact resistance but may require additional corrosion protection, especially in regions with high humidity or salt exposure.

Pros include excellent weather resistance, long lifespan, and design flexibility. However, metal roofs can be noisy during rain or hail, and their installation often demands skilled labor, which could impact project timelines and costs. For international buyers, compliance with standards such as ASTM or EN (European Norms) is essential to ensure quality and safety, especially when importing from regions with different manufacturing standards.

Polycarbonate

Polycarbonate is a high-impact, weatherproof thermoplastic that provides excellent UV resistance and thermal insulation. Its translucency allows natural light to filter through while protecting occupants from harmful UV rays, making it ideal for regions with intense sunlight like the Middle East or tropical zones in South America and Africa. Polycarbonate panels are lightweight, easy to install, and require minimal maintenance, offering a cost-effective solution with a long service life.

From a B2B perspective, polycarbonate is advantageous because it can be manufactured in various colors and textures, accommodating aesthetic preferences across regions. It is also resistant to chemical corrosion, suitable for coastal environments. Buyers should verify that the polycarbonate complies with regional safety standards, such as JIS or ASTM, and consider the availability of local suppliers to reduce import costs and lead times.

Wood

Wood offers a natural aesthetic and is favored in regions where traditional or rustic designs are preferred, such as parts of Europe or South America. It provides good shading and can be customized easily. However, wood is susceptible to rot, insect infestation, and weathering, especially in humid or rainy climates, unless properly treated and maintained.

For international buyers, sourcing sustainably managed wood that complies with environmental standards like FSC or PEFC is critical. Treatment methods such as pressure-treating or sealing can extend lifespan but may increase costs. Additionally, transportation of heavy timber can be costly, and local availability influences overall project budgets.

In-depth Look: Manufacturing Processes and Quality Assurance for pergola roof

Manufacturing Processes for Pergola Roofs: Core Stages and Techniques

The production of pergola roofs for B2B markets involves a series of meticulously controlled stages, each critical to ensuring structural integrity, aesthetic quality, and long-term durability. The process begins with material preparation, progresses through forming and fabrication, and concludes with assembly and finishing. Each stage employs industry-standard techniques, tailored to the specific materials used—such as aluminum, steel, polycarbonate, or composites—while adhering to strict quality protocols.

Material Preparation
This initial phase involves sourcing high-quality raw materials compliant with international standards. For metals like aluminum and steel, suppliers often provide certifications (e.g., mill test reports) confirming chemical composition, tensile strength, and corrosion resistance. For plastics and composites, suppliers furnish data sheets verifying impact strength, UV stability, and chemical resistance. All incoming materials undergo Incoming Quality Control (IQC) checks, including visual inspection and dimensional verification, to ensure conformity before entering production.

Forming and Fabrication
Key techniques include cutting, bending, and welding, which are performed with precision machinery such as CNC cutters, press brakes, and robotic welders. Aluminum and steel components are often cut to size using CNC laser or plasma cutting for high accuracy. Bending processes utilize hydraulic or pneumatic presses to shape profiles, ensuring tight tolerances. Welding, including MIG, TIG, or spot welding, joins components securely, with weld quality scrutinized through non-destructive testing (NDT) methods like ultrasonic or radiographic inspection. For polymer-based components like polycarbonate panels, extrusion and thermoforming are common, ensuring uniform thickness and optical clarity.

Assembly and Integration
The assembled pergola roof involves integrating the formed components into the final structure, often using mechanical fasteners, rivets, or specialized clips. Modular assembly lines facilitate efficient joining of panels, beams, and support structures, with fixtures and jigs used to maintain alignment. During assembly, In-Process Quality Control (IPQC) ensures dimensional accuracy, proper fastening, and correct component placement. For example, assembly checks include verifying gasket placement for waterproofing and ensuring load-bearing elements meet design specifications.

Finishing Processes
The finishing stage enhances durability and aesthetics. Powder coating is a common method for metal parts, providing corrosion resistance and a wide palette of colors. The process involves pre-treatment (e.g., phosphating or anodizing), followed by electrostatic application of powder, and curing in ovens at specified temperatures. For plastics, UV coatings or surface treatments prevent degradation. Final inspections include visual checks for surface defects, coating uniformity, and dimensional conformity.

Quality Control Checkpoints
IQC (Incoming Quality Control): Verifies raw material properties, dimensions, and certifications before processing.
IPQC (In-Process Quality Control): Conducted throughout manufacturing, including dimensional checks, weld integrity, and assembly accuracy.
FQC (Final Quality Control): Ensures finished products meet all specifications, with inspections for surface finish, coating quality, and structural integrity.

Testing Methods
Mechanical Testing: Tensile, shear, and impact tests on materials and finished components to ensure they meet strength requirements.
Environmental Testing: UV exposure, corrosion resistance (salt spray testing), and temperature cycling, critical for outdoor pergola structures exposed to diverse climates.
Dimensional Inspection: Using coordinate measuring machines (CMMs), laser scanners, or calipers to verify compliance with design tolerances.
Waterproofing & Leak Testing: Simulated rain tests to confirm sealing and drainage effectiveness, especially for roofing panels.

Comprehensive Cost and Pricing Analysis for pergola roof Sourcing

Cost Components Breakdown

When sourcing pergola roofs internationally, understanding the key cost components is essential for effective negotiation and pricing strategy. Materials typically constitute 40-60% of the total cost, with options ranging from metals like aluminum and steel to plastics such as polycarbonate and vinyl. High-quality, certified materials—especially those with UV resistance, fire retardants, or corrosion-proof finishes—tend to carry premium prices. Labor costs vary significantly depending on the country of origin; manufacturing in regions with lower wages (e.g., parts of Southeast Asia or South America) can reduce expenses but may impact quality or lead times. Manufacturing overhead includes tooling, setup costs, and plant expenses, which are amortized over production volume. For bespoke or highly customized designs, tooling costs can be substantial upfront but decrease per unit with larger orders.

Quality Control (QC) measures, including inspections and certifications (ISO, CE, etc.), add to costs but are critical for ensuring compliance with international standards. Logistics and shipping often represent 15-25% of total costs, heavily influenced by the chosen Incoterms, shipping modes, and destination port efficiencies. For buyers in Africa, South America, the Middle East, or Europe, freight costs can fluctuate dramatically based on proximity and logistical infrastructure. Lastly, margin—the profit added by manufacturers or distributors—can range from 10-30%, depending on the competitiveness of the market and order volume.

Essential Technical Properties and Trade Terminology for pergola roof

Key Technical Properties for Pergola Roofs

Material Grade
Material grade specifies the quality and strength of the roofing components, such as aluminum, steel, or polycarbonate. Higher grades (e.g., 6061 aluminum or commercial-grade steel) ensure durability, corrosion resistance, and longer lifespan, which are critical for outdoor applications. B2B buyers should prioritize suppliers offering materials with recognized standards to guarantee performance in various climate conditions.

Thickness and Gauge
The thickness, often expressed in millimeters or gauge (for metals), impacts the structural integrity and load-bearing capacity of the pergola roof. Thicker materials can withstand stronger winds, heavier snow loads, and prolonged exposure to the elements. Clear specifications help buyers assess whether a product meets local weather requirements and safety standards.

Tolerance Levels
Tolerance refers to the permissible variation in dimensions during manufacturing, typically measured in millimeters or as a percentage. Tight tolerances (e.g., ±0.5mm) ensure precise fitting and ease of installation, reducing on-site adjustments and labor costs. For international projects, understanding tolerance standards helps maintain consistency across components from different suppliers.

UV and Weather Resistance
This property indicates how well the roofing material withstands ultraviolet radiation, moisture, and temperature fluctuations. High UV resistance prolongs the aesthetic and structural integrity of materials like polycarbonate or fabric roofs. Buyers should verify certification and testing reports to ensure materials are suitable for their specific climatic conditions.

Load and Wind Resistance Ratings
These ratings specify the maximum loads the pergola roof can support, including snow, rain, or wind pressure. Ratings are often provided in terms of PSI or specific wind speed thresholds (km/h or mph). Selecting materials and designs with appropriate resistance ratings is vital for safety and longevity, especially in regions prone to extreme weather.

Finish and Coating
Surface finish, such as powder coating or anodizing, enhances corrosion resistance and aesthetic appeal. Durable coatings prevent rust, fading, and degradation over time, reducing maintenance costs. Industry standards specify the type and thickness of coatings, allowing buyers to compare longevity and quality across products.


Common Industry and Trade Terms

OEM (Original Equipment Manufacturer)
Refers to companies that produce pergola roofing components which are then branded and sold by other firms. Understanding OEM relationships helps buyers evaluate product authenticity, customization options, and potential for private labeling, which are vital for branding and large-scale projects.

MOQ (Minimum Order Quantity)
The smallest quantity a supplier is willing to produce or sell in a single order. Knowledge of MOQ is essential for budgeting, planning, and avoiding excess inventory. Larger projects may require negotiating MOQ to ensure supply flexibility.

RFQ (Request for Quotation)
A formal process where buyers solicit price and lead-time estimates from multiple suppliers. An RFQ allows for apples-to-apples comparison of costs, delivery schedules, and service terms, facilitating better purchasing decisions.

Incoterms (International Commercial Terms)
Standardized trade terms published by the International Chamber of Commerce that define responsibilities for shipping, insurance, and tariffs. Familiarity with Incoterms (e.g., FOB, CIF) ensures clarity on who bears costs and risks at each stage of delivery, which is critical for international procurement.

Lead Time
The period from order placement to delivery. Shorter lead times can accelerate project timelines, especially in fast-paced markets. B2B buyers should verify supplier lead times and assess their capacity to meet project schedules.

Warranty Terms
Details regarding the coverage period and scope of product guarantees against defects or failures. Clear warranty terms provide assurance of product quality and reduce post-installation risks, especially important in regions with challenging weather conditions.

3. What are typical minimum order quantities (MOQs), lead times, and payment terms for international pergola roof procurement?

MOQs vary depending on the manufacturer but generally range from 20 to 50 units for standardized products; custom designs may require larger orders. Lead times typically span 4 to 12 weeks after order confirmation, depending on complexity and production capacity. Payment terms often include a 30% deposit upfront with the balance payable before shipment or upon delivery. Some suppliers accept letters of credit or bank guarantees for larger orders. Clarify these terms early, and negotiate flexible payment options aligned with your cash flow and project schedules.
